The 8th Indian Super League (ISL) football series in Goa has reached its final stage.

In the series, four teams – Jamshedpur, Hyderabad, ADK Mohan Bagan and Kerala Blasters – qualified for the semi – finals in terms of points.

Each of these teams will face the opposing team twice in the semifinals. At the end of the match, the team with the winning or goal difference qualifies for the final.

Accordingly, the Kerala Blasters beat Jamshedpur 1-0 in the first semi-final.

Yesterday again the two teams clashed in the 2nd semi-final round. Kerala could have qualified for the final if they had drawn the match.

Kerala player Luna scored the first goal in the 18th minute of the match. Holder scored for Jamshedpur in the 50th minute.

The match ended in a draw as neither team scored until the end of the match. Kerala won the first match and drew the second and qualified for the final.

ADK Mohan Bagan-Hyderabad clash in the second semi-final today.
